12 November 2007

ORBITAL PARTICIPATION IN THE SMALL ENGINE TECHNOLOGY CONFERENCE

Orbital attended and presented technical papers at the Small Engine Technology Conference ("SETC") held recently at Niigata, Japan on October 29th to 31st 2007.

The SETC conference is an international event bringing together participants from all key countries in the world to discuss and present new technologies and developments across a wide range of non automotive engine products, from motorcycles and outboards though to general purpose industrial and the hand held lawn and garden products.

With the ever increasing emission control being implemented for non-auto engines on a global basis, the SETC conference has taken on the role as a leading forum for the non automotive engine industry, with the theme for this 13th SETC conference being "Sustainable Mobility - Energy Conserving for the Future".

Orbital presented two technical papers at this SETC conference reporting on developments at Orbital to investigate future emission control well beyond the most stringent outboard emissions in place today, and in the development of a new concept engine for performance vehicles such as All Terrain Vehicles (ATV's) and motorcycles. The papers are entitled "Beyond 3 Star Emission Capability for Outboard Engines" and "A Fresh Approach to the Design of Clean Engines for the Performance Motorcycle Market" and will be available on Orbital's web-site after publication.
